Koovagam Kuttantavar Temple
E1385391
UNEXPLORED
Koovagam Kuttantavar Temple is a renowned Tamil Nadu shrine dedicated to the deity Kuttantavar and is famous for its annual festival that draws large gatherings, including members of the transgender community, for unique marriage and mourning rituals.
